Global Warming Trends Concern Scientists
As the Earth continues to experience a two-year surge in global warmth, scientists around the world are growing increasingly concerned about the potential impacts of this trend on the environment and its inhabitants. The rising temperatures, attributed to various factors including human activities and natural cycles, have prompted a sense of urgency among researchers and policymakers to address the root causes and mitigate the consequences of climate change.
The recent uptick in global temperatures has been the subject of intense scrutiny among the scientific community. Data from climate monitoring stations and satellite observations reveal a consistent pattern of rising temperatures across continents and oceans, indicating a significant deviation from historical norms. Such deviations, when sustained over an extended period, can have far-reaching consequences for weather patterns, sea levels, and ecosystem dynamics.
One of the key concerns raised by scientists is the potential exacerbation of extreme weather events due to the increased global warmth. Heatwaves, droughts, hurricanes, and wildfires are expected to become more frequent and intense as temperatures continue to rise, posing serious threats to human lives, infrastructure, and biodiversity. The cascading effects of these events can trigger chain reactions in the environment, leading to widespread disruptions in ecosystems and food systems.
In addition to the immediate risks posed by extreme weather events, the long-term consequences of global warming are equally troubling. Sea-level rise, driven by the melting of polar ice caps and glaciers, threatens coastal communities and low-lying regions with inundation and erosion. The displacement of populations, loss of biodiversity, and disruption of livelihoods are among the social and economic challenges that could result from unchecked climate change.
